Webjobs that hire 14 year olds in tucson, azall complaints need to be handwritten true or false st francis prep high school death whiting funeral home williamsburg, va obituaries Tucson Teens (ages 14-21) – Get a job this summer with the Pima County Summer Youth Employment Program, which will give you career skills and get you ready for college. Plus, earn money in a 20-40hr/week position! Available jobs include administrative support, clerk, child care aide, recreation aide, … See more Applicant must be between ages 14-21 (MUST TURN 14 BY May 20, 2024) and a permanent resident of Pima County. Verification of date of birth and residency will be required during the orientation process. See more If you are not currently enrolled in school, you must schedule and take an assessment test. Note that the TABE isn’t a pass or fail test. … See more If your teen has an IEP or 504 plan in school, please call 520-724-9639 and ask for the disability documentation that needs to be attached to his/her report card or unofficial transcript.
